Midtown Station Food Hub
Multi-vendor food hall in downtown Ocala overlooking Tuscawilla Park, with six independent businesses sharing one roof. Tenants include Infinite Ale Works (brewery), Sipping Grounds Coffee, Shake Shack, La Pin Sausages, plus rotating counter-service and a full bar program. Hours vary by vendor, but the hub itself stays lively from morning coffee through late dinner — built for the gather-and-graze pattern more than a sit-down meal.
